Environmental Project Manager
Company Description
SPEC Consulting is a multi-disciplinary consulting engineering firm based in Albany, NY that provides engineering, project management and environmental services to various industries. SPEC is a small firm with excellent flexibility and great opportunity for growth. SPEC handles multi-million dollar projects for a variety of clients, including the petroleum and chemical industries. SPEC provides opportunities to learn all aspects of projects and to apply and develop your engineering and technical skills. SPEC offers excellent benefits including health, dental, flexible spending and 401k matching programs. A highly competitive salary structure based on qualifications and substantial bonus opportunities are available.
Job Description
Key Duties and Responsibilities
- Define, organize, execute, and coordinate environmental, permitting, engineering, project management assignments, primarily for clients in the fuel and chemical distribution industries terminals and pipelines, and in the chemical manufacturing industry. Typical assignments include site assessments, due diligence evaluations, overall project management, permit strategy development, permit applications, client representation through permitting process, permit expediting, environmental compliance reviews and consulting including air, water, and soil, able to lead project teams comprised of various disciplines, project concept to completion.
- Plan, organize, and supervise work of technical staff, engineers, scientists, designers and administrative staff supporting those assignments.
- Select and define scope of environmental projects and industrial related problems to guide investigations. Plan and develop solutions to those problems that often require novel concepts and approaches.
- Interface with key clients and project staff in formal, informal, and project team meetings.
- Proficient in a lead role in areas of project, technical, environmental compliance, and communications with local, county, state, and federal agencies.
- Provide clients with on-site construction management assistance during installation, commissioning and start-up of equipment and related systems.
Qualifications
Experience with key duties and responsibilities described above are a requirement. Strong candidates will possess the following qualifications and experience:
- A BA/BSEnv, BSCE, BSME or BSChE degree and minimum of 5+ years consulting experience in environmental, manufacturing or other industrial projects.
- Ability to apply project management techniques commonly used in industrial capital projects, environmental permitting, remediation, and compliance.
- Excellent written and oral communication skills.
- Working knowledge of office productivity software including spreadsheets and word processing.
- Working knowledge of AutoCAD, CADWorx, and GIS software a plus.
- Experience in fuel and chemical storage and distribution facilities a plus.
- Ability to acquire professional certification or registration within two years.
